First and foremost, passion for acting is the driving force behind any aspiring actress. At 13, it is crucial to have a genuine love for performing, storytelling, and the art of acting. This passion will fuel the determination and perseverance needed to navigate the competitive industry.

One of the initial steps in becoming an actress at 13 is to develop basic acting skills. This can be achieved through various means, such as enrolling in acting classes, workshops, or summer programs. These programs often provide a foundation in acting techniques, improvisation, and scene study, which are essential for building a strong acting repertoire.

Building a portfolio is another vital aspect of becoming an actress at a young age. This involves creating a collection of headshots, resumes, and audition reels that showcase the individual’s talent and versatility. It is important to seek professional guidance when compiling these materials to ensure they are of high quality and reflect the actress’s unique qualities.

Networking is key in the entertainment industry, and young actresses should start building their connections early on. This can be done by attending industry events, joining acting groups, and connecting with other performers and professionals. Building a strong support system of mentors, agents, and fellow actors can provide valuable advice, opportunities, and moral support throughout the journey.

Once the foundational skills and connections are in place, the next step is to start auditioning for roles. This can include auditions for school plays, community theater, and local productions. It is important to remain persistent and not get discouraged by rejections, as the acting industry is highly competitive. Each audition is an opportunity to grow and refine one’s skills.

As an actress at 13, it is crucial to maintain a balance between acting and other aspects of life. Balancing school, extracurricular activities, and personal time is essential for overall well-being and long-term success. Young actresses should prioritize their education and ensure they are well-rounded individuals.
